John I have had good luck with toothpaste and a soft cotton rag. You have to use the paste cause the gel won't work. BTDT I use ColgateIt takes the wiper rash out then I treat the windshield with RainX to keep it off. |

| Burrhead, I had a glassman tell me not to use RainX as it puts a film on the window that makes it so they can not spot fix a rock chip. Not sure if he knew what he was talking about. I still use RainX. I like the way the rain beads off the window without using your wipers. It's a lot safer than having a film of grasshopper guts to see thru at night during a T-storm. |
